The Jewish Russian Community Centre of Ontario (JRCC) will host the GTA`s central Hanukkah celebration with the lighting of a giant Hanukkah menorah at Mel Lastman Square, 5100 Yonge Street, on Monday, December 15 at 6 PM, the second night of the eight-day holiday.
With the approach of the Chag HaGeulah of Yud-Tes Kislev, Rabbi Yehuda Krinsky released an open letter to the community, reminding everyone to take part in the annual ‘Chalukas Hashas,’ an initiative begun by the Alter Rebbe following his release from prison.

A spectacular Yud Tes Kislev farbrengen and celebration drew an estimated 5,500 participants this week at the renowned Cirque Phénix in Paris, marking one of the largest Chabad gatherings in the region.

>With great sadness we report the passing of Harav Chananya Sinai Dovid Halberstam OBM, known affectionately across the Chabad community as “Chesed Halberstam”, a beloved chossid and devoted helper of the Rebbe and Rebbetzin. He passed away on Monday evening, the 19th of Kislev, 5786.

Rabbi Chaim Brikman, Chabad-Lubavitch emissary to Sea Gate and Coney Island in Brooklyn, N.Y., shepherded his community through a hurricane and flooding, a synagogue fire and other challenges all while battling serious illness that never broke his spirit or held him back.
